Output d8ba0d7b057b30c8e8db0711097a94de5daadfde21a381b04345521788835e78:0

value
1043245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f0871c23d24daf3ebc349ac540fca9662e0dba7 OP_EQUAL
address
34X6zDTbBbThh6ofGFPnP3RBvFJJPwEkmL
transaction
d8ba0d7b057b30c8e8db0711097a94de5daadfde21a381b04345521788835e78
confirmations
365550
spent
true